Killstar, also known as Killstar Occult Luxury, is a Scottish Goth lifestyle and apparel company that markets goods made in China through the internet. It is a division of Draco Distribution Ltd., with an office address of 1037 Sauchiehall Street, Glasgow, United Kingdom, G3 7TZ, and a warehouse at Unit 9 Boundary Rd, Rutherglen, Glasgow, G73 1DB.

Draco Distribution Ltd was incorporated on September 18th, 2013 for the retail sale of clothing in specialized stores. It registered the Coven Cosmetix brand line of beauty, bath, and laundry products in 2016; the Killstar trademark for clothing and housewares in 2017; and the Kreeptures line of toys, games, and jewelry in 2017.

Most of the graphics used on Killstar clothing and accoutrements are starkly black and white, and although designed exclusively for Killstar, they are often reminiscent of earlier graphics from Europe and the United States, and they are imprinted with words in English.

In the late 2010s, the company released two fortune telling tea cups and saucers, as part of its line of Goth drink ware. These are the Killstar Cosmic cup and saucer and the Killstar Zodiac cup and saucer.
